Transaction 60ea5059d5126bf2523111632eee92af52f6029645c5486598874ad70687070a
1 Input
1 Output
-
60ea5059d5126bf2523111632eee92af52f6029645c5486598874ad70687070a:0
- value
- 3595243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28f41f1e049a368ba59ad2336a2c9dc9212f2d28 OP_EQUAL
- address
- 35RZQ5aXtXWD5pzup8uUeTyh2oAZ3mZBZQ